Hire 2 law firms for $120,000 to handle employee investigations and labor disputes

In Plain English

The city needs outside help with workplace investigations and employment law issues. Oppenheimer Investigations Group gets $80,000 to investigate personnel problems. The existing law firm Bertrand Fox gets an additional $40,000 for labor and employment legal advice.

Why This Vote Matters

The council approved $120,000 in contracts for outside legal help, with Councilmember Butt dissenting and Councilmember Bates abstaining. The city will pay Oppenheimer Investigations Group $80,000 to handle workplace investigations and give an additional $40,000 to law firm Bertrand Fox for employment legal advice. This spending addresses personnel problems and labor law issues that the city's internal staff cannot handle alone. The contracts were part of the consent calendar, which typically contains routine administrative items that pass without individual discussion.
